This enlarged,
two-part longitudinal section of a human incisor is engineered for
high-fidelity anatomical instruction in secondary and medical vocational
curricula. Calibrated for clarity in dental morphology studies, the model
facilitates the identification of enamel, dentin, and pulp cavity structures.
It complies with international educational standards for biological modeling,
providing a ruggedized, tactile resource for high-volume classroom utilization.

Key Pedagogical Outcomes
·
Bi-parting longitudinal section: Enables internal visualization of the pulp
cavity and root canal, facilitating student mastery of dental histology.
·
Chromatically differentiated layers: Provides clear visual contrast between enamel,
cementum, and dentin, supporting Bloom’s Taxonomy in "Understanding"
and "Analyzing" tissue differentiation.
·
Numeric indexing with Key Card: Promotes self-directed learning and summative
assessment accuracy during laboratory practicals
·
Enlarged macro-scale format: Ensures visibility for group demonstrations,
reducing the need for individual specimen handling in high-capacity lecture
environments.
